Sa sala (The eating room)

Mar 29th, 2010 | Di | Categoria: Connotu - Tradizioni

It is the large room that today guests the eating room, and it was in origin a smith laboratory. When it was than enclosed in the rest of the house, the room was divided in three separate rooms, hiding also the splendid trussed ceiling which has been today rediscovered.

In a corner a nice fire place warms the ambient ant creates a causy atmosphere. At the other side, a large screen shows imagines of today’s and yesterday’s Sardinia, as if it was a big painting with moving images.

.

A painted “greek line” decoration that rapresents the zodiacal signs in the style of the Sardinian tapestry, surrounds the room.
